About this property
Secluded Mountain Cabin In Apple-Picking Country
Perched deep in the woods near apple orchards, the Biltmore Estate, and Lake Lure, this sunny log cabin features 4 bedrooms (2 queen upstairs, 1 queen and 1 bunkbed set downstairs), 3 baths, upstairs and downstairs living areas with televisions, a well-stocked kitchen, and a ping-pong table in the garage. It's a great set-up for families with kids.
Enjoy the rocking chairs on the covered back deck as you look out over a wooded hill with winter views. The covered front porch supplies a picnic table and charcoal grill for outdoor eating.
Spend your afternoons tubing on the Green River, fishing in nearby trout streams, apple-picking in conveniently located orchards, climbing Chimney Rock, exploring the Blue Ridge Parkway, visiting the Biltmore Estate, or enjoying antique-hunting, dining, and music in nearby Asheville and Hendersonville. Our central location puts you within 25 minutes of all these activities.
If you want a real get-away, a place that is not in a busy neighborhood or housing development, our cabin in the woods may be for you. It it laid back and secluded, although still within 15 minutes from all kinds of large grocery stores, big-box stores, and restaurants in Hendersonville.
The final 1.3 miles to the cabin are on a rough dirt road that gets rather steep right before the cabin's driveway. The dirt road portion is about a 5-6 minute drive and do-able in regular cars, except in icy conditions, when it is best to have an SUV or 4-wheel drive. (We regularly drive up in a Toyota Prius or Dodge Mini-Van and have no problems, but we go slowly. It is important to remember that this IS a mountain dirt road!)
